    For new buyers - I don't know what to say, I do not want to rob him of his opinions... but on some topics I don't at all relate to him, so here are my opinions. First of all, It's not that hard to handle... Consider a 5ft 9 person who has never ridden a bike, I had a few options in front of me, and I tried a couple of them including this and xpulse as well as some other ones. This seemed the smoothest and easiest to me to start, ride and come to a stop (and I learned how to ride a bike on my test ride - consider that). 1. Beginner friendly and Height? This is a beginner friendly bike, gears are very forgiving with long ranges, no vibrations at low RPMs and just overtakes anything and If you are really good at riding it won't give you trouble even at 5.4". The guy I learned it from was 5.3" and easily got on it had his one leg reaching the ground at any time and he took this to the road, down from the showroom down and up to the godown... I have seen 5.6 and 5.7 people riding the new himalayan at 835 mm comfortably on Himalayas and Ladakh. It's just the rider who needs to handle it and the bike is very light weight and slim for that. If you are moderatly good, consider that min height of 5ft 7 and above will be good with the low seat (810mm) if you're really a beginner biker like me consider 5ft 9 minimum with the higher seat height (835mm). I am still riding it with 810mm after a month plus of riding everyday in highways and streets as I was very underconfident with any bike... but I will soon be changing it as the 835 mm one has more cushion. 2. If that's cleared up, I am a first time rider I bought it in Delhi (for 2.33L) and it's not a waste of money neither does it look cheap to me. 2.3L is also not a lot of money in the two wheeler market rn... There's basically no other bike in this segment under 2L so this is the absolute budget bike and still looks like a sport bike to be honest! (like a proper V-strom) I don't know what the OP expected out of this money. If you're considering Xpulse. It just is better off roader due to the suspensions.. but it's an absolute rough bike, with a rough engine and gear shifts and battery problems and not a beginner friendly one... I went twice for test rides - I felt it even sounds like a motocross bike with the rattling sound 3. No the 810mm seat doesn't ruin your stance.. It just depends on person to person and how you like to ride it, It's just not that comfortable as the other one. 4. Handle, Gears, Engine Problems? I didn't face any handling problems (probably after riding for an year or so who knows?), with time the gears have become smoother.I don't have much experience like the reviewer but I can say that I have heard nothing but good things about this engine and he's saying that the engine is not that smooth.. It's just reliable. I mean I have never experienced it and for sure.. I feel like this engine is smooth AF which almost all of the reviewers say with the Suzuki engine - It's the best thing about the bike! 5. City Ride? It's a must-have city bike... It's made for cities, this is the most opposite thing of my experience... I have researched a lot of normal city bikes as well (not ADV) it's the best among those with 120mm... and It doesn't eat up the bumpers and all but its so smooth even if take it up and down a footpath or small bumpy roads which there are a lot in my area... which I regularly do for parking and whenever heading out. Of course nothing compared to a Himalayan and sorts they have 200mm that is why they can't call it a proper Adventurer... but it is a perfect tourer and city bike, perfect for highways and office commutes - If not me listen to the bike guy Shumi. I found out that this review was of all things negative for most things especially for design which the OP says he doesn't like... well it's not everyone's cup of tea, like Himalayan's not mine, so go with your taste. With some things I agree but for most of them... I think... not so much My use case? I use it for regular commutes which I also enjoy every bit of it. Also, I want to tour on it sometimes but I am not a hardcore tourer, if I do that a lot. I might switch to the BMW 310 GS or Benelli (or the himalayan 451 better equipped but not my cup of tea for the design and its weight). Leaving this huge comment to help my fellow V-strom buyers.. It's not Himalayan, It's not Xpulse, It's also not an absolute tank.. It's Vstrom, sporty and lightweight and just in the right budget with an engine that is smooth AF. Update: I'm not 5ft 9", I am 5ft 7" actually I mentioned it to be that because I was using a very high heel shoes which atleast makes me 5ft 9 because I just learned bikes in general and had low road confidence. After 4 months of riding now I regularly wear normal flat shoes. Sure, I have to scoot my butt over to one side (just an inch maybe) to flat foot but it becomes a muscle memory and you're more aware of when you want to keep your feet down. Only downside is getting stuck in a crawling traffic for 30 minutes (which you will find only in Indian streets) you will feel a little tired with your legs all stretched out (but you get used to handling a tall bike and I don't feel it anymore even in traffic) other than that everything remains the same and I love it even more 😍

    @@Vushan108 If it's majorly for commuting go for XSR. If you want decent of all(Commuting, Highway Rides and entry level mild off road) go for Vstrom 250) Both has its own advantages it's the purpose for which you want. XSR gives you better mileage, easy in city traffic comparatively and agile riding feedback. But not comfortable for long Highway tours and off road cos of less power, suspension and GC. Vstrom is decent in city not as good as XSR. Good at highways and Ok for mild offroad. But turns less mileage per litre and maybe a little bit costlier on the maintenance compared to XSR. And if you are below 5.8 height. Seat height is also on the higher side on Vstrom that affects easy handling in the city commute. Both are good bikes just different purpose built

    I agree with you on some of the points mentioned. I have ridden it now 6k km in 90 days approximately Good points 1. Brakes 2. Engine is awesome - No vibrations and exceptional mileage (upto45kmpl if ridden constantly at 80kmph) 3. Seat - very broad and long and well cushioned Improvement areas : 1. Suspension - Front forks are horrible, and the rebond in potholes is sharp and causes wrist pain 2. Tyres - I use it for touring and the tyre noise is really high on highway and it gets annoying on long tours 3. World famous suzuki service stations.. Pata nai kab sudhrenge ye log😂 I want to say I am 5ft 5 inches tall guy and I use it for daily office commute in bangalore and highway tours, I think I am able to ride it comfortably in bumper to bumper traffic.. If you are short rider on this bike you need to have confidence and right technique... I still struggle sometimes on slopes and inclinations but I think you can live with it.
